I am Kevan Shelton, the co-founder and CEO of Park Street Homes, a trailblazing company dedicated to transforming urban landscapes through innovative real estate solutions. With a deep-seated passion for community development and a vision to make sustainable and affordable housing accessible, I have led our company to become a leader in urban restorative development across the southern United States.🏗 Professional Journey:My career began in the field, literally from the ground up, working in family-owned real estate ventures. This hands-on experience provided me with an intimate understanding of the intricacies of building and development, from site selection to final sales. With a degree in Construction Management from the University of Houston, I honed my skills to eventually launch Park Street Homes, fulfilling a need for quality housing in underserved urban communities.💼 What I Do:At Park Street Homes, I oversee strategic planning and operation, focusing on innovation in homebuilding and community development. My role involves extensive collaboration with investors, city planners, and community leaders to ensure our projects not only meet market demands but also foster community growth and resilience. I’m particularly proud of pioneering a successful REG-CF campaign on StartEngine, making us the first traditional homebuilder to tap into this innovative funding mechanism to democratize real estate investment.🌍 Community Impact:Believing strongly in the power of homeownership to change lives, I co-founded Black Men Buy Houses, an initiative aimed at increasing homeownership rates among African American men. This program has already empowered thousands with the tools to build wealth through real estate, impacting communities nationwide.🎙 Media and Speaking Engagements:I am a frequent speaker on topics ranging from entrepreneurship to housing policy, appearing in media outlets such as Black Enterprise, Essence, and local television stations like Fox and ABC. My insights have also been featured in industry panels and conferences, where I advocate for sustainable development and equitable housing policies.🏆 Recognitions:My contributions to the industry and community have been recognized with several awards, including being named to Houston Business Journal’s 40 Under 40 in 2024.
